I would be very careful. I read a couple of months ago that the authorities in Berlin had put a ban on whole of property renting through airbnb for holiday type lets. They will impose a fine of up to 1OO,OOO euros on property owners who defy this ban. There was a tv program last night in the UK which stated exactly the same thing. I also read, but have not heard anything further, that some areas of Paris are looking to impose something similar.
The problem seems to be that many landlords are no longer renting their properties to local families and long term tenants, instead they are looking to maximise their profits through airbnb and similar agencies. As I understand it, there is no restriction on renting our rooms in the home you live in.
